深入探索以太坊开发:加密货币的未来与创新
引言
在近几年来,加密货币市场如火如荼,涌现出了诸多新项目和新技术。其中,以太坊(Ethereum)作为第二大加密货币平台,以其独特的智能合约功能和去中心化应用程序(dApps)生态系统在行业内占据了重要地位。以太坊不仅支持代币的发行和交易,更是为各种创新的金融科技应用提供了基础设施。本篇文章将深入探讨以太坊的开发,以及其在加密货币行业中的未来影响。
以太坊的基本概念
以太坊是一个开源的区块链平台,由程序员维塔利克·布特林(Vitalik Buterin)于2015年推出。与比特币主要专注于数字货币转账的功能不同,以太坊的设计理念是为了支持智能合约的执行。智能合约是一种自动执行并执行合约条款的代码,它可以在没有第三方干预的情况下完成交易,使交易过程更高效且安全。
以太坊的原生货币称为以太(Ether, ETH),它不仅可以用作交易媒介,还用于支付用户在以太坊网络上运行应用程序时所需的“气费”(Gas Fees)。这些费用主要奖励矿工验证交易,维护网络的安全性和稳定性。
以太坊的技术架构
以太坊的技术架构主要由以下几个部分组成:
- 区块链:以太坊采用链式数据结构,每个区块包含交易数据和对前一个区块的哈希值,确保数据的完整性和不可篡改性。
- 智能合约:智能合约是以太坊平台的核心,开发者可以使用Solidity等编程语言编写智能合约实现各种商业逻辑。
- 去中心化应用(dApps):通过智能合约构建的去中心化应用,能在无需信任的环境中进行各种交易和交互。
- 以太坊虚拟机(EVM):以太坊虚拟机是一个运行智能合约的环境,支持多种编程语言的部署,为dApps提供了执行的基础。
以太坊的发展历程
以太坊从2014年开始筹备,2015年正式上线,经过数年的发展,已经经历了多个重要的技术更新和升级。
在其发展初期,以太坊的ICO(初次代币发行)引发了广泛关注,许多开发者和投资者纷纷参与其中。随着以太坊的使用案例逐渐增加,网络拥堵、交易费用高昂等问题开始显现。这也促使以太坊团队着手进行升级,以提高网络的可扩展性与安全性。
在2020年,以太坊2.0(Eth2)项目的启动标志着其迈入了一个新的阶段。以太坊2.0采用权益证明机制(Proof of Stake, PoS)来取代传统的工作量证明机制(Proof of Work, PoW),旨在提高网络性能和降低能耗。通过向更高效的验证过程过渡,以太坊2.0预计将解决现有系统中的许多瓶颈问题。
以太坊与加密货币市场的关系
以太坊作为一个平台,不仅仅是数字货币的代币(ETH),更是无数加密货币项目的基础。许多新兴的代币例如USDT、LINK和UNI等都是在以太坊平台上发行的。这些代币和项目的成功运作,都与以太坊的技术架构密不可分。
随着DeFi(去中心化金融)和NFT(非同质化代币)的兴起,以太坊的需求急剧上升,进一步推动了ETH的价格上涨。这些应用场景不仅扩大了以太坊的使用范围,也吸引了传统金融界的目光,促进了投资者对区块链技术的认知与接受。
可能相关的问题
以太坊如何实现智能合约的安全性?
在以太坊平台上,智能合约的安全性是一个至关重要的话题。尽管智能合约具备自动执行的优势,但一旦编写出现漏洞,可能会导致严重的资金损失。为此,以下几个方面可以帮助提高智能合约的安全性:
首先,代码审查是确保智能合约安全的第一步。开发者在发布智能合约之前,需让第三方安全审计公司进行代码审查,找出潜在的漏洞。这个过程虽然费用较高,但对于保护投资者的资金尤为重要。
其次,使用开发框架可以减少错误的机会。许多开发者选择使用现有的开发框架和库,诸如OpenZeppelin,以便快速构建合约并减少从零开始编码时可能出现的错误。
再者,测试网络的使用也是一项重要的安全措施。开发者可以在以太坊的测试网络(如Rinkeby、Ropsten)上进行充分测试,模拟不同情况下合约的执行,以发现潜在问题。
最后,升级与维护也是智能合约操作的另一关键。许多项目在设计合约时,允许通过某种方式进行合约升级,以便及时修复发现的漏洞。
综上所述,确保智能合约的安全性不仅是技术问题,更是开发和维护过程中的高标准要求。
以太坊在去中心化金融(DeFi)中的角色是什么?
去中心化金融(DeFi)是近年来区块链行业的热门话题,它通过智能合约提供传统金融服务的去中心化版本。以太坊在DeFi生态系统中扮演了无可替代的角色。
首先,以太坊独特的智能合约功能为DeFi应用的实现提供了技术支持。通过智能合约,用户可以在没有中介的情况下进行借贷、交易、投资,这种形式提高了交易的透明度和效率。
其次,以太坊的开放性使得更多的开发者能够在这个平台上创新和构建新的DeFi项目。仅在2020年,就有诸如Compound、Aave、Uniswap等重要的DeFi项目出现在以太坊之上,用户的资金可以通过这些平台进行自由运作。
此外,对于用户而言,以太坊的去中心化性质意味着他们可以保留自己资产的控制权,而不必担心中心化金融机构的合规和审查。这种特性极大地吸引了对隐私和自由度有较高要求的用户。
然而,尽管DeFi在以太坊上的迅猛发展,但它也面临着挑战,例如网络拥堵、高额手续费等问题,促使以太坊生态系统中的创新不断加速,以应对这些瓶颈。
NFT和以太坊的结合如何推动数字艺术市场的发展?
非同质化代币(NFT)是一种对独特数字资产的证明,这些资产可以是艺术作品、音乐、视频等。NFT的兴起与以太坊的结合在最近几年内极大地推动了数字艺术市场的发展。
首先,以太坊提供的智能合约功能使得NFT的创建、销售和转移变得简单快捷。艺术家可以利用这种技术发行自己的作品,避免了传统艺术市场中的中介问题,直接与买家建立连接,从而提高了收益。
其次,以太坊提供了一种唯一且不可篡改的数字所有权证明。买家在购买NFT时,可以确保证明其作品的唯一性和所有权,这对于艺术作品的汇价机制至关重要。
举例而言,数字艺术家Beeple的一幅NFT作品在佳士得拍卖行以6900万美元成交,显示了NFT在现代艺术市场中的价值认同。这一事件不仅震惊了艺术界,也引发了社会各界对数字艺术市场的广泛讨论。
然而,NFT市场的快速发展也带来了相应的问题。比如,由于以太坊网络的高昂手续费,许多潜在买家在交易过程中可能会因费用问题放弃购买。此外,市场上NFT的快速涌现也增加了虚假和抄袭作品的风险。因此,行业各方需要在技术、法律和市场环境方面共同努力,确保这一市场的健康和可持续发展。
以太坊2.0的实施将给行业带来哪些变化?
以太坊2.0的实施旨在通过过渡到更为高效的权益证明机制(PoS)来改善网络性能和可扩展性。其技术更迭和实现将对整个区块链行业产生深远影响。
首先,网络效率的提升是以太坊2.0的一个核心目标。采用权益证明机制可以显著提高区块链的交易速度,降低确认时间,从而为大规模商用奠定基础。这将吸引更多企业和开发者在以太坊上构建应用。
其次,环境影响的减少是另一关注点。在传统PoW机制下,以太坊网络的能耗极为庞大,而转向PoS后,能耗预计将大幅下降,为环保和可持续发展贡献一份力量。
此外,安全性和去中心化程度的提高也是以太坊2.0的目标之一。权益证明机制鼓励更多的用户参与网络的维护与治理,提高了网络的整体安全性,降低了长期持有者的操控风险。
然而,以太坊2.0的实现过程并不是一帆风顺的,它面临着技术挑战和时间上的不确定性。开发团队需确保更新过程中的兼容性,以便当前的以太坊用户能够顺利迁移到新系统。用户的参与和反馈也将决定以太坊2.0的成功与否。
结论
以太坊作为一个去中心化的区块链平台,不仅在加密货币的交易中扮演了重要角色,更是推动了智能合约、DeFi和NFT等多个领域的创新。随着网络的持续发展,特别是以太坊2.0的推进,我们预计将看到更多的应用场景和商业模式。无论是开发者还是投资者,都值得密切关注这一平台的动态,共同见证加密货币行业的未来。
``` 以上内容围绕“以太坊开发加密货币”主题进行了详细阐述,并提供了相关问题的深入解答。希望对您有帮助!